Jodi Rubenstein has a long history in the real estate industry in
New York City. Upon moving to New Jersey in 1998, she immediately
got involved with residential real estate with her partner
Joanna Parker-Lentz. The team began working together at
Prudential New Jersey Properties in Millburn.
They moved to RE/MAX Village Square in the beginning of 2000.
Since their start with RE/MAX, the team continuously maintains
their high ranking in the company. The dynamic duo closed over 60 in 2005.
In 2006, Jodi and Joanna were
ranked 10 in the state of New Jersey for RE/MAX and closed over 40
transactions. Both received RE/MAX Platinum sales awards
for 2004, 2005 and 2006. Jodi and Joanna have been inducted
into the prestigious Re/Max Hall of Fame in 2006.
